What helps with stress and burnout?

It’s essential to replenish your physical and emotional energy, along with your capacity to focus, by prioritizing good sleep habits, nutrition, exercise, social connection, and practices that promote equanimity and well-being, like meditating, journaling, and enjoying nature.

How long is burnout supposed to last?

How Long Does Burnout Last? It takes an average time of three months to a year to recover from burnout. How long your burnout lasts will depend on your level of emotional exhaustion and physical fatigue, as well as if you experience any relapses or periods of stagnant recovery.

Am I burnt out or lazy?

Burnout is the result of environmental factors that may not be under the control of the person. Laziness, on the other hand, is considered to be more of an avoidance or lack of effort by choice. It seems to be driven less by stress and more by an avoidance of unwanted or unpleasant experiences.

What are the 4 stages of stress burnout?

World Health Organization as a phenomenon caused by chronic stress at work, and cites four key indicating signs: Feelings of energy depletion or exhaustion; mental distancing from a job; feeling of negativity or cynicism towards professional duties; and a decrease in work efficacy.

What is the best burnout inventory?

The Maslach Burnout Inventory (MBI) is considered the “gold standard” for measuring burnout, encompassing 3 scales: emotional exhaustion, depersonalization, and personal accomplishment.
